The challenges of the new school, that of the 21st century, and founded on the principles of pedagogical leadership in its teachers, allow them to enter into a transmutation of the teaching and learning processes. The openness aimed at innovation reaches an ideology which we are going to convey throughout this article through the so-called Pedagogical Metamorphosis as pragmatism of the teaching task.
Stimulating the educational environment in the classroom through gamification brings the infant and adolescent closer to the multidimensional exploration of knowledge. The motivational principle in rural environments is decisive for the achievement and scope of pedagogical metamorphosis, as a precept towards human formation.
This writing is socio-pedagogical in nature. It seeks to raise awareness among teacher-researchers about the importance of innovating in educational settings through their tasks. For this reason, the paradigm used is critical, since the idea of ??understanding the rural educational context and scenario is promulgated, and going beyond it by transforming teaching practice.
It is sought, therefore, that learning environments in rural areas, as is the case of Santa Rosa del Sur, not only serve to reconstruct the social fabric deteriorated by violence, but also to consolidate a perspective of orientation and training for life as the function of the school should be.
